Job Description

Job description
Responsibilities:
• Prepare and review federal and state individual, business, and trust income tax returns
• Oversee the day-to-day operations of audit, review, compilation, and preparation engagements
• Perform accounting of complex areas of clients' balance sheet and income statements
• Oversee the completion of clients' financial statements
• Analyze small business accounting records and make adjustments for tax returns and financial statements
• Delegate and conduct tax research and planning for small business clients
• Develop and cultivate professional client relationships
• Supervise, develop, and motivate staff and provide them with counseling and career guidance

Qualifications:
• Minimum 3 years prior public accounting experience
• Active Colorado CPA licensure is a plus
• Supervisory experience
• Comprehensive knowledge of current tax and audit issues
• Oil and gas industry knowledge is a plus
• Attention to detail with strong organizational, time management, analytical, client service and PC skills including Microsoft Excel and accounting software proficiency
• Strong work ethic with the ability to identify complex accounting issues, juggle multiple priorities and meet deadlines in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ment
